In August 2025, the unemployment rate rose to 5.9%, with a total of 481,000 unemployed, the majority being men.

The seasonally adjusted unemployment rate for August 2025 was 5.9%, an increase of 0.1 percentage points compared to July. The total number of unemployed was estimated at 481,000, an increase compared to 471,200 in July and 464,700 in August 2024. The unemployment rate is higher for men (6.2%) than for women (5.5%), and among young people (15-24 years) it reached an alarming level of 23.5%. For adults (25-74 years), the rate was 4.7%.
